摘要
在人工智能技术飞速发展的时代背景下,中小学人工智能教育已成为落实国家战略、培养创新人才的重要途径。本文结合吉林省的区域实践,针对当前中小学人工智能教育在软硬件条件、师资力量、课程体系等方面存在的现实问题,构建了“课题引领—示范辐射—资源协同”的RM-R(Research-Modeling-Resources)模型,通过组建学科研究团队、召开省级示范现场会、建设分层分类教学资源库等系统性举措,有效推动了人工智能教育由局部试点向全域覆盖转变、由规模扩张向内涵提升迈进。实践表明,该模式能够突破发展瓶颈,为区域人工智能教育高质量发展提供了可借鉴的实施范式。
Against the backdrop of rapid advancements in artificial intelligence technology,AI education in primary and secondary schools has become a critical pathway for implementing national strategies and fostering innovative talent.This paper,drawing on regional practices in Jilin Province,addresses the practical challenges currently faced in AI education at these levels,such as limitations in hardware and software facilities,teacher ca-pacity,and curriculum systems,and by proposing an R-M-R model(research-modeling-resources)framed around"project leadership,demonstration outreach,and resource coordination".Through systematic measures including forming disciplinary research teams,organizing provincial-level demonstration conferences,and developing a tiered and categorized teaching resource repository,this model has effectively facilitated the transition of AI edu-cation from localized pilots to comprehensive coverage and from scale expansion to quality enhancement.Prac-tice has demonstrated that this approach can break through development bottlenecks and provide a replicable im-plementation paradigm for high-quality regional AI education.
